Title

Ratifying the Appealed Special Tax Assessment for Property at 992 HATCH AVENUE. (File No. VB1601, Assessment No. 168800)

 

Hearing Date(s)

Date of LH:  9/1/15

Date of CPH: 1/6/16

Tax Assessment Worksheet

Cost:  $1440

Service Charge:  $155

Total Assessment:  $1595

Gold Card Returned by:  DALE ROSS

Type of Order/Fee: VB FEE

Comments:    VB FILE OPENED ON 12/23/14.

01/06/2015: Change to Cat 1 - Per LHO Marcia Moermond: Change to VB1 and hold vb fee for 90 days to allow PO time to get CofO reinstated.   Ms Moermond denied variance on cedar fence blocking rear egress window. PO stated he will remove that portion of the fence. ~MD   Garbage/Rubbish (Abated) 03/24/2015: Change to Cat 2 - Per Fire Inspectors Neis and Martin: "Life safety issues remain, change VB file back to VB2, CCI needed." ~MD 03/24/2015: *Recheck - There is a bagster full of junk/refuse in rear near garage, will allow 1 week to remove. ~MD 04/01/2015: *Recheck - Vacant, secure and maintained at the time of my inspection. VB placards remain posted. ~MD 07/23/2015: *Recheck - Vacant, secure and maintained at the time of my inspection. ~MD Next Schedule Date: 08/24/15.  C of O HAS NOT BEEN REINSTATED.   

 

Body

WHEREAS, the Office of Financial Services Real Estate Section has attached to this Council File both a report of completion outlining the costs and fees associated with Vacant Building Registration fees billed during October 30, 2014 to May 21, 2015. (File No. VB1601, Assessment No. 168800) and the assessment roll including all properties for which these assessments are proposed for Council ratification; and

 

WHEREAS, the City Council’s Legislative Hearing Officer has reviewed an appeal of this assessment and developed a recommendation for the City Council with respect to this assessment; and

 

WHEREAS, a public hearing having been conducted for the above improvement, and said assessment having been further considered by the Council and having been considered financially satisfactory; Now, Therefore, Be It

 

RESOLVED, that pursuant to Chapter 14 of the Saint Paul City Charter, said assessment is hereby ratified and payable in one installment.
